Creating Headlines

Configuring mySupport Portals

 

Support representatives with applicable permissions can create informational headlines and enable display via the following methods:

For support representatives using the Desktop, you can display headlines in views and feeds, as well as in the Notification Center list and popup.

For customers using a mySupport portal, you can display headlines in a mySupport-enabled views and feeds, as well as the Notification Center list and popup.

 To access the Headline entry screen, select  Headline on the Desktop Create menu. Note that you can also create a new headline from the Incident and Problem entry screens. Headline Entry Screen Example

Expires

Select the day on which the headline should no longer display. (The headline will not display on this day.)

Available to Customers

Select Yes to enable display of the headline on a mySupport portal.

Show in Desktop Notification Center

Select Yes to enable the headline for display on a mySupport portal in the Notification Center list and popup. The popup will appear each time the customer logs in until the headline expires or is deleted.

Notification Center Popup Enabled

Select Yes to display the headline in a popup in the Notification Center list on a mySupport portal.

Notification Center Message

Enter the text to display in the list of notifications accessed via the Desktop Notification icon.

Available to Support Reps

Select Yes to enable display of the headline on the Desktop.

Show in Desktop Notification Center

Select Yes to enable the headline for display in the Notification Center list and popup; when the support representative clicks on the headline in the list, it will display in the Headline Entry screen.

The popup will appear each time the support representative logs in until the headline expires or is deleted.  A "Reactivate Desktop Notification?" prompt will appear every time the headline is saved in this screen; select Yes to re-display the headline in the list and popup if it had been dismissed earlier.

Notification Center Popup Enabled

Select Yes to display the headline in a popup in the upper right corner of the Desktop.

Notification Center Message

Enter the text to display in the list of notifications accessed via the Desktop Notification icon.

Message

Enter the headline to display in views, feeds,  the Desktop and/or mySupport portal. You can use HTML tags to format the text.

If the Show in Desktop Notification Center field is enabled for customers, this text will appear as the first paragraph in the Notification Center dialog that appears when the headline is clicked in the list.

Details

Enter additional information for the headline; you can use HTML tags to format the text. If the Show in Desktop Notification Center field is enabled for customers, this text will appear under the message in the Notification Center dialog that appears when the headline is clicked in the list.

Viewing History

Use the History tab to view notations on all headline actions.

Restricting Access

Use the Group Access tab to restrict display of a headline to members of support representative and customer groups. Click the Add link to display the following dialog for selecting the groups. After you add one or more groups and save, the headline will display only to members of the selected groups. Note that group access permissions restrict the ability to open a record; data will still display in views, charts, and reports.

Associating Work Items

Use the Associated Work Items tab to associate an existing incident or problem with the headline.

Publishing to Twitter

The Twitter Twitter icon icon will appear in the Headline screen if you have the Publish to Twitter permission and a Twitter application has been entered in the Options and Tools | Social Media Integration | Twitter Application screen; when clicked, the Publish to Twitter dialog will appear with the contents of the message and details (for headlines) or the short description (for problems). If multiple Twitter applications have been created, you can select the account to which the headline or problem should be published.
